Steven Curtis Chapman Chosen As Next Grand Ole Opry Member
A western Kentucky native and multi-Grammy and GMA Award-winning artist will soon be the newest member of the Grand Ole Opry. During Saturday night’s live show, Cordell, Kentucky native Ricky Skaggs invited Steven Curtis Chapman, from Paducah, to be the newest member of the famed ‘Home of Country Music.’

Cardinals Notes: Edman, Brebbia, Matz, Kloffenstein
While the Cardinals are looking to buy at the deadline as they chase an NL wild card slot, the team could also pursue some strategic selling, as the Athletic’s Fabian Ardaya reports that the Dodgers have interest in Tommy Edman’s services. The versatile Edman could provide depth or even a starting role at multiple positions for an injury-riddled Dodgers team, and it be can argued that St. Louis already has enough position-player depth to make Edman expendable.
